| Sign of malfunction | Possible cause | Method of elimination |
| When braking, the car deviates to one side | Presence of grease or oil on the surface of the brake lining | Replacement of the lining |
| Incorrect contact of the brake lining with the brake disc or drum | Adjust contact | |
| Malfunction of the automatic transmission, brake regulator | Adjust | |
| Brake drum eccentricity or uneven wear | Repair or Replace | |
| Insufficient braking force | Low brake fluid level or contamination | Topping up or replacing fluid |
| Presence of air in the brakes | Pumping the system | |
| Overheating of the brake rotor due to seizure of the brake linings | Adjust | |
| Presence of grease or oil on the brake linings | Replacement of linings | |
| Poor contact of brake pads with disc or drum | Adjust | |
| Brake booster malfunction | Adjust | |
| Clogged brake line | Blowing | |
| Defective metering valve | Valve replacement | |
| Increased brake pedal travel | Presence of air in the brake system | Pumping the system |
| Wear of brake linings | Replacement | |
| Damage to the vacuum hose | Replacement | |
| Brake fluid leak | Elimination | |
| Malfunction of automatic. brake regulator | Adjust | |
| Increased clearance between the pushrod and the master cylinder | Adjust | |
| Master brake cylinder failure | Replacement | |
| Brake drag | Incomplete release of wheels when applying the handbrake | Adjust |
| Incorrect parking brake adjustment | Adjust | |
| Brake pedal return spring defective | Replacement | |
| Wear and damage to the return spring of the rear drum brake shoes | Replacement | |
| Lack of lubrication in moving parts | Lubricate | |
| Incorrect clearance between the tappet and the brake master cylinder | Adjust | |
| Damage to the return spring of the master brake cylinder piston | Replacing the spring | |
| Brakes grabbing while driving | The parking brake does not release completely | Correction |
| Incorrect parking brake adjustment | Adjust | |
| The brake pedal return spring is weak | Replacing the spring | |
| The return line of the master cylinder is clogged | To correct | |
| Defective return spring of rear drum brake mechanism | Replacement | |
| Lack of lubrication in rubbing parts | Lubricate | |
| The master cylinder check valve or piston return spring is faulty | Replacement | |
| Insufficient clearance between the rod and the master cylinder | Adjust | |
| Poor parking brake performance | Wear of brake linings | Replacement |
| Excessive travel of the parking brake lever | Adjust the lever stroke | |
| Grease or oil getting on the surface of the brake pad | Replacement of the lining | |
| Automatic malfunction. brake regulator | Adjust | |
| Parking brake cable jammed | Replacing the cable |
Brake system — malfunctions (Hyundai Elantra J2)
